			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><img class="alignleft" style="margin: 10px;" title="Portable Printers" src="http://www.instablogsimages.com/images/2009/03/04/digital-photo-printer-dpp-fp67-and-dpp-fp97_fiblS_54.jpg" alt="" width="330" height="165" />Sony have unveiled there latest portable printers. The DPP-FP67 and the DPP-FP97 Digital Portable Photo Printers. They both allow for printing  4 by 6-inch photos on demand. Both printers have LCD screens, so you are able to edit and adjust your snaps before you print. Printing takes around 60 seconds per picture. The main difference between the models is that the DPP-FP97 along with printing the regular media files also features a HDMI port and supports Compact Flash. <p><img class="alignleft" title="printer-pz310-design2" src="http://i.dell.com/images/global/products/printers/printers_highlights/printer-pz310-design2.jpg" alt="" width="353" height="276" />This is the Dell Wasabi PZ310 portable printer.</p>
<p>It is one of the smallest printers that i have ever seen. It looks stunning and is available in a number of different colours (black, blue and blue), so should match your netbook PC very nicely!</p>
<p>The unit can connect via the normaly USB, but what is clever is that it will also connect to your phone and pc via bluetooth, which means neat cableless printing. The printer uses no ink, this is embedded somewere in the paper and will print out sticky backed photo sized prints for you to use how ever you wish.</p>
